WATCH?? | Back in 1904 Dr. Seaman A. Knapp, who started the “demonIw
stration method of teaching improved farming practices, stated: •“The object of all such demontstrations is to test or prove some ^Important fact bearing upon agriIcultural conditions. If these demonstrations are conducted in liuch a way that few persons see Jthe result, or learn about them, little is accomplished.” Just recently several demonstrations* (method and result) were conducted. I hope the small attendance at these demonstrations was due to this being the planting-har
